PNC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

1,165 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PNC Financial Services (PNC)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$56.1B — up 5.9% from $53B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 163 funds opened new PNC positions and 52 closed out — a net gain of 111 holders — while 378 added to existing stakes and 407 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$281M. The largest seller was Aberdeen Group, cutting an estimated $299M.
